Andhra revises Cyclone Montha damage to Rs 6,384 cr
The Free Press Journal - Indore
|November 11, 2025
Seeks urgent aid of Rs 900 cr
-
The Andhra Pradesh government on Monday revised the estimate of damage caused by Cyclone Montha to Rs 6,384 crore and sought an immediate relief of Rs 900 crore after a central team visited the state to assess the loss.
An eight-member InterMinisterial Central Team (IMCT) led by Pasumi Basu, Joint Secretary, Ministry of Home Affairs, and K Ponnuswamy, Director, Ministry of Agriculture and Farmers’ Welfare, visited the state today.
The state earlier pegged the preliminary loss at Rs 5,265 crore.
